It will discuss 2K WB PU coatings to be used in those areas has hygiene requirements. Such areas including interior wall of food processing plant, kitchen, hospital as well as clean rooms of electronic plant, kindergarten or school. The coatings can achieve seamless application with excellent chemical resistance and easy for cleaning. Very low VOC of this system can meet the high requirements for interior applications. |

Corrosion protection is a permanent challenge. Experts estimate that one-third of all iron and steel products manufactured worldwide in a year are used to replace corroded structural components. A matter of equal importance is sustainable corrosion protection. The primary focus here is on systems with high durability and a long lifespan, good color/gloss retention and stability, which at the same time are able to combine commercial needs with environment requirements. The lecture has the aim to illustrate in a comprehensive form the advantages of combing the best properties of silicone and epoxy chemistry by taking SILIKOPON® EF as an example for this new silicone-epoxy hybrid technology. Based on test results and studies the findings were presented and benefits explained. |

Wetting and dispersing additives are used since decades to stabilize pigment particles in solvent-borne and aqueous coating formulations. Besides pigment wetting their main function is to prevent flocculation of the particles by keeping them separated through steric stabilization. To be effective in this way, the additives have to adsorb onto the pigment surface and build a protective layer around the particles. Such additives must have in their chemical structure one or more anchor groups for the adsorption on the pigment surface and several polymer segments that are compatible with the binder system and create steric stabilization. |

Using an innovative proprietary process, the Easy-to-disperse innovative preparation are prepared by combining a novel acrylic resin, additive compound and high quality pigments. The dust-free preparations can be solubilized in water or a waterborne binder within 45 minutes using a dissolver and small amounts of ammonia, amine or KOH resulting in a paste with broad compatibility with most of the waterborne raw materials. Conventional milling is no longer necessary. In the presentation we will focus on the performance of this innovative preparation in different coatings system showing evaluation results and application examples. |
